The Concept of AI Buyer Preference Matching in Residential Real Estate

AI buyer preference matching completely reshapes property-buyer connections. This smart approach studies what buyers want, how they behave, and what's happening in the market to suggest homes that genuinely fit individual needs.

This targeted automation replaces the old-school manual filtering real estate agents used to rely on. By crunching data at incredible speeds, these systems deliver more personalized property suggestions.

Think of this AI as your digital house-hunting buddy that keeps getting smarter with every interaction and property listing it sees.

These systems track buyer behavior with impressive detail, noting search patterns, viewing time, saved properties, and property inquiries.

By reading these digital breadcrumbs, AI can spot preferences buyers haven't even mentioned. For example, if someone keeps clicking on homes with large backyards, the AI might prioritize similar properties in future recommendations.

AI chatbots and virtual assistants make the matching even better by answering buyer questions 24/7, booking property tours, and helping with initial paperwork.

Time-Consuming Aspects of Manual Buyer Preference Matching

Identifying the time sinks in manual buyer preference matching helps you understand the areas that need streamlined workflows.

Manual Filtering and Listing Overload

Residential real estate agents often drown in listings, trying to find the perfect match for their clients. This manual process creates missed opportunities hidden in the mountain of listings.

Human errors from fatigue and information overload can lead to overlooking ideal properties.

Slow responses when new properties hit the market can mean missing out on potential matches.

This problem gets worse in hot markets. Agents might spend hours filtering properties only to discover many are already under contract.

Difficulty Capturing Nuanced Buyer Preferences

Understanding what buyers really want, beyond their checklist of bedrooms and bathrooms, is tough. Traditional methods fall short because standard questionnaires don't adapt to changing preferences.

Casual conversations miss important details that could lead to better matches.

Some preferences are felt rather than spoken, making them difficult to capture in traditional search parameters.

A buyer might say they want a "cozy" home, but what feels cozy varies dramatically between people. Traditional methods struggle to translate these fuzzy concepts into concrete search criteria.

Reactive Rather Than Proactive Searching

Old-school property matching reacts to what buyers say they want, rather than predicting what might delight them. This creates problems with slow responses to perfect new listings.

There's often an inability to adjust quickly when markets shift, resulting in missed opportunities.

Picture a buyer who sets a $500,000 budget, unaware their perfect home costs $525,000. A reactive approach would miss this opportunity, while a smarter system might recognize when to bend the rules.

The fallout is real. Frustrated buyers lose enthusiasm, searches drag on, and deals fall through. Meanwhile, agents waste precious time tweaking search filters and manually comparing listings against buyer wish-lists.

Machine Learning Algorithms for Personalized Recommendations

Smart algorithms sift through mountains of data to find patterns and deliver spot-on property suggestions.

Collaborative filtering works like Netflix recommendations; if two buyers have similar patterns, properties that delighted one might appeal to the other. These methods rely on AI techniques for pattern recognition to analyze buyer behaviors and preferences.

Content-based filtering matches specific home features to buyer preferences, connecting the dots between what people say they want and what they actually click on.

Continuous Learning and Feedback Adaptation

AI agents pay attention to how buyers interact with listings, which properties keep them scrolling, what they save for later, and which homes prompt them to ask questions.

These interactions serve as feedback, helping the system refine its understanding and improve future recommendations. The more a buyer uses the system, the smarter it gets about their true preferences, exemplifying how AI agents automate processes, improving real-time customer engagement.
